ALEXANDRIA, Va., Feb. 11 -- United States Patent no. 12,544,334, issued on Feb. 10, was assigned to UCL BUSINESS LTD (London).
"Metabolisable pH sensitive polymersomes" was invented by Giuseppe Battaglia (London), Alessandro Poma (London) and Denis Cecchin (London).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"The present application relates to pH-sensitive polymersomes. The polymersomes are capable of degradation at endosomes' mild acidic pH into resorbable materials, which also allows avoiding liposome premature degradation of the payload once internalised inside the cells. The polymersomes can thus be used in methods for the treatment or prevention of diseases."
